Windows Computers: (Internet Explorer)
  • Windows 7 users may need to download the free Google Chrome web browser in order to view the webcams.
  • First time visitors to the site may be required to install ActiveX software. If this is not already installed on your computer, then an installation message will appear on your screen or in your pop-up blocker in Internet Explorer. Follow the instructions to install the software.
  • To view a full screen view of the webcam, press the Full Screen button. To return to the normal view, click anywhere in the screen.
  • To view a larger image of the webcam feed, select the "Client Setting" tab on the left side of the screen and change the view size to 640 x 480.
  • To use the Zoom controls, select the Zoom button. Increase or decrease the zoom amount by using the "W" and "T" buttons. In the preview window, drag the gray square to the location you wish to zoom in on. Select the Zoom button again in order to close the Zoom controls.
  • To capture a real time picture of Wood Island LIghthouse, select the "Snapshot" button. A snapshot of the current view on the webcam will be taken and display in a new pop-up window. Select the "Save" button to save the image to a location on your computer.
  • The Pause button may be used to pause the webcam's video feed.
  • The Stop button may be used to stop the webcam's video feed.
  • There is no audio available with the webcam, so those controls are inactive.
